The National Testing Agency (NTA) has announced that the CUET PG Registration 2026 process is approaching its final stage. Candidates aspiring to pursue postgraduate courses in central and participating universities must complete their application on or before January 14, 2026, as no extension has been notified.
Missing the deadline could mean waiting another full year to apply, making timely registration crucial for aspirants.
CUET PG Registration 2026: Important Dates
- Registration Start Date: December 14, 2025
- Last Date to Apply: January 14, 2026
- Correction Window: January 18 to January 20, 2026
- Exam Month: March 2026

How to Apply
The CUET PG application process is conducted entirely online. Candidates must apply through the official website: exams.nta.ac.in/CUET-PG
Application Steps:
- Register using a valid email ID and mobile number
- Fill in personal, academic, and contact details
- Upload required documents in the prescribed format
- Pay the application fee online
- Download and save the confirmation page for future reference
Applicants should ensure that all details are accurate before final submission.
CUET PG Correction Window 2026
NTA will provide a one-time correction facility for candidates who make minor errors during registration. The correction window will be open from January 18 to January 20, 2026.
Only selected fields will be editable, and careless mistakes may still lead to application rejection. Candidates are advised to review their forms carefully.

Examination Details
The CUET PG 2026 examination will be conducted across India and select international locations, allowing wide accessibility for candidates.
- Subjects Offered: 157 postgraduate subjects
- Exam Medium: Most papers will be bilingual (English and Hindi), except language-specific courses
- Mode of Examination: Computer-Based Test (CBT)
